As I advised you in the past, I would never do surgery on an adult pup with luxating patellas that are not causing issues with him walking. I don't recall how old Thumper is. A lot of vets advise this surgery and sadly it is what I believe a money maker for them.... the problem with doing it in an adult is that the wear and tear on the cruciate ligament has already occurred. If they tear that ligament down the road, the poor pup is back in having knee surgery and it is very expensive on top of it. Young pups under the age of 2 is differnt...then if you repair the LP it is less likely you will have a tear of the CCL down the road. Of course it CAN happen, but less likely since the knee is not popping in and out.
